And there are three dead-eye stages. The first is you hit dead-eye and then you can target while the game has slowed down. The second stage you just roll the cursor over targets and it paints on little target things. Then you hit trigger and you can shoot like 6 people at once. The third stage (which I'm not at yet), you actually hit a button to paint on targets, it doesn't auto-paint. So you have a lot more control over your targets.
